Overview
- Max Verstappen remains under contract with Red Bull until 2028, though performance clauses may allow an early exit.
- Reports suggest Aston Martin's Saudi backers are prepared to offer Verstappen a deal worth £230 million over three years, fueling rumors of a 2026 switch.
- Aston Martin has officially reaffirmed its commitment to current drivers Fernando Alonso and Lance Stroll for 2026 and beyond.
- Honda will shift its engine allegiance to Aston Martin, with Adrian Newey dedicating his focus to the team's 2026 car development.
- Speculation also includes Saudi Arabia's Public Investment Fund seeking greater ownership of Aston Martin, though no sale has been confirmed.
